      Album Details

      Immerse yourself in the enchanting world of Stéphane Grappelli with "Olympia 1988," a live album that captures the essence of his legendary performance at the iconic Olympia in Paris. This 16-track collection, released in 2005 by Rhino Atlantic, is a testament to Grappelli's mastery of jazz, swing, and French jazz, offering a vibrant and dynamic listening experience.

      The album features Grappelli's virtuosic violin playing alongside the brilliant piano skills of Martial Solal, creating a harmonious blend of talent that is sure to captivate any jazz enthusiast. From the upbeat "Pick Yourself Up" to the soulful "Ol' Man River," each track showcases the duo's exceptional chemistry and musical prowess.

      "Olympia 1988" is not just a collection of songs; it's a live recording that transports you to the heart of the performance, allowing you to experience the energy and passion of Grappelli and Solal as they bring these classic tunes to life. The album's duration of 1 hour and 7 minutes ensures a comprehensive journey through their setlist, highlighting their versatility and range.

      Whether you're a longtime fan of Stéphane Grappelli or a newcomer to his music, "Olympia 1988" is an essential addition to your jazz collection. The album's blend of timeless classics and Grappelli's unique style makes it a standout release that celebrates the enduring legacy of one of jazz's most beloved artists.

      About Stéphane Grappelli

      Stéphane Grappelli, born on January 26, 1908, in Paris, France, was a legendary figure in the world of jazz, renowned for his mastery of the violin and piano. His musical journey began at a young age, inspired by his father, an Italian music enthusiast. Grappelli's career soared when he co-founded the "Quintette du Hot Club de France" with the iconic Django Reinhardt, becoming one of the most celebrated jazz violinists of the 20th century. His soulful renditions of French jazz, swing, and traditional jazz captivated audiences worldwide, earning him a place among the greats. Even at the age of 84, Grappelli continued to enchant listeners with his timeless melodies, performing on stages across the globe with nothing but his beloved violin. His discography includes timeless tracks like 'Baby' and 'Minor Swing,' which continue to inspire and delight music lovers everywhere. Grappelli passed away on December 1, 1997, in Paris, leaving behind an enduring musical legacy that continues to influence generations of musicians.
